Analysis
The most recent figure for debt service (ppg and imf only, % of exports of goods, services and) in Africa Western and Central is 9.9%, measured in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 11.7% on the previous year and up 292.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, debt service (ppg and imf only, % of exports of goods, services and) in Africa Western and Central peaked at 16.5% in 1996 and was at its lowest, 1.4%, in 2012.
Africa Western and Central ranks 10th of 32 groups on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
Debt service, the sum of principal repayments and interest actually paid in currency, goods, or services, is expressed as a percentage of exports of goods and services--all transactions between residents of a country and the rest of the world involving a change of ownership from residents to nonresidents of general merchandise, net exports of goods under merchanting, nonmonetary gold, and services. This series differs from the standard debt to exports series in that it covers only long-term public and publicly guaranteed debt and repayments (repurchases and charges) to the IMF.
